How much do research lab tech jobs pay per hour?

As of May 30, 2026, the average hourly pay for research lab tech in the United States is $22.03,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.38 and $27.40 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Research Lab Tech,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Research Lab Tech, you need a solid background in laboratory techniques, data collection, and scientific principles, usually supported by a degree in biology, chemistry, or a related field. Familiarity with lab equipment, safety protocols, and software such as Microsoft Excel or specialized data analysis tools is typically required. Attention to detail, strong organizational skills, and effective communication set outstanding candidates apart. These skills ensure accurate data collection, safe laboratory environments, and reliable support for scientific research projects.

What are some typical challenges a Research Lab Tech might face when supporting multiple ongoing experiments?

A Research Lab Tech often juggles various tasks, such as preparing samples, maintaining equipment, and managing data for several experiments simultaneously. One common challenge is effectively prioritizing tasks to ensure deadlines are met without compromising the quality or accuracy of results. Additionally, lab techs must be vigilant about following safety protocols and maintaining detailed records to support reproducibility. Strong communication and organizational skills are essential, as the role frequently involves collaborating with researchers and adapting to shifting project needs.

What are Research Lab Technicians?

Research Lab Technicians are professionals who support scientific investigations by preparing experiments, maintaining laboratory equipment, and recording data. They work in various fields such as biology, chemistry, and medical research, assisting scientists in conducting experiments and analyzing results. Their responsibilities often include handling samples, managing inventories, and ensuring safety protocols are followed. Research Lab Technicians play a crucial role in keeping labs organized and research projects running smoothly.

What is the difference between Research Lab Tech vs Laboratory Assistant?

AspectResearch Lab TechLaboratory Assistant
CredentialsAssociate's degree or relevant certificationHigh school diploma or equivalent
Work EnvironmentResearch labs, often in academic or biotech settingsClinical or research laboratories, hospitals, or clinics
Job DutiesConduct experiments, maintain equipment, record dataPrepare samples, clean equipment, assist with basic tasks

Research Lab Techs and Laboratory Assistants both work in laboratory settings, but Research Lab Techs typically have more specialized training and handle more complex experiments. Laboratory Assistants support daily lab operations with basic tasks. The roles often overlap, but Research Lab Techs usually perform more technical duties and data analysis.

Job Summary

Carries out a broad range of technically advanced research activities and procedures; evaluates conclusions and has considerable latitude to modify or devise methods and techniques as necessary to achieve desired results; typically supervises technical and sometimes administrative elements of the research unit.
Does this position require Patient Care? No
Essential Functions
-Executes protocols of non-routine experiments.
-Assists PI with determining the most suitable methodology.
-Performs basic design and modification of protocols.
-Calculates, transcribes, and analyzes data.
-Prepares and presents reports.
-Organizes and summarizes acquired data using scientific and Statistical Techniques.
-Participates in the design of experiments or field work.


Qualifications

EducationBachelor's Degree Related Field of Study requiredCan this role accept experience in lieu of a degree?YesLicenses and CredentialsExperiencePrevious Research Lab Experience 1-2 years requiredKnowledge, Skills and Abilities- Analytical skills and ability to resolve technical problems. - Ability to interpret acceptability of data results. - Strong Computer skills. - Demonstrated competence in research techniques and methodologies.
